263 - Current Management of Urinary Tract Infections


‐ Mar 15, 2014 1:45pm


Credits: None available.

This session offers a review of simplevs. complex infections including appropriate imaging, dosing and antibiotics. A review of urologic anatomy along with predisposing risk factors and risks of recurrence are presented along with definitions of terms used to describe UTIs.

Objectives:
  • List the four classifications of UTI's.
  • Identify acute and chronic infections of GU tract.
  • Discuss which antibiotics are used and when.
